Sweet Potato Brownies
Ingredients:
1 cup cooked and mashed sweet potato (about 1 large or 2 medium sweet potatoes)
1/2 cup almond butter (or any nut/seed butter)
1/3 cup maple syrup (or honey)
1/4 cup cocoa powder
1 tsp vanilla extract
1/2 tsp baking soda
1/4 tsp salt
Optional add-ins: 1/4 cup chocolate chips, chopped nuts, or dried fruit
Instructions:
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ease an 8×8-inch baking pan or line it with parchment paper.
Prepare the sweet potatoes: Pierce the sweet potatoes with a fork and bake at 400°F (200°C) for 45-60 minutes, or until soft. Alternatively, you can microwave them for 6-8 minutes, turning halfway through.
Mash the sweet potatoes: Once cooked and cooled, scoop out the flesh and mash it until smooth.
Mix the batter: In a large bowl, combine the mashed sweet potato, almond butter, maple syrup, cocoa powder, vanilla extract, baking soda, and salt. Stir until well mixed. Fold in any optional add-ins like chocolate chips.
Pour the batter into the pan: Spread the mixture evenly in the prepared baking pan.
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out mostly clean (a little moist is fine).
Cool and serve: Let the brownies cool in the pan before slicing.
